Mass. Gen. Laws ch. 41, § 19H

Maximum amount of additional compensation for serving as member of registrars of voters

Notwithstanding the limitation contained in section nineteen G, in a city or town which accepts this section the total amount of additional compensation payable to its clerk who also serves as a member of its board of registrars of voters shall not exceed two thousand dollars.
